- (djm) Added check for broken snprintf() functions which do not correctly
   terminate output string and attempt to use replacement.
4 files changed
tree: 003880eaf4ddfda40e01a1baee5f2d85f69e2704
  1. contrib/
  2. acconfig.h
  3. aclocal.m4
  4. atomicio.c
  5. auth-krb4.c
  6. auth-options.c
  7. auth-options.h
  8. auth-pam.c
  9. auth-pam.h
  10. auth-passwd.c
  11. auth-rh-rsa.c
  12. auth-rhosts.c
  13. auth-rsa.c
  14. auth-skey.c
  15. auth.c
  16. auth.h
  17. auth1.c
  18. auth2.c
  19. authfd.c
  20. authfd.h
  21. authfile.c
  22. authfile.h
  23. aux.c
  24. bsd-base64.c
  25. bsd-base64.h
  26. bsd-bindresvport.c
  27. bsd-bindresvport.h
  28. bsd-daemon.c
  29. bsd-daemon.h
  30. bsd-misc.c
  31. bsd-misc.h
  32. bsd-mktemp.c
  33. bsd-mktemp.h
  34. bsd-rresvport.c
  35. bsd-rresvport.h
  36. bsd-setenv.c
  37. bsd-setenv.h
  38. bsd-snprintf.c
  39. bsd-snprintf.h
  40. bsd-strlcat.c
  41. bsd-strlcat.h
  42. bsd-strlcpy.c
  43. bsd-strlcpy.h
  44. bufaux.c
  45. bufaux.h
  46. buffer.c
  47. buffer.h
  48. canohost.c
  49. ChangeLog
  50. channels.c
  51. channels.h
  52. cipher.c
  53. cipher.h
  54. clientloop.c
  55. compat.c
  56. compat.h
  57. compress.c
  58. compress.h
  59. config.guess
  60. config.sub
  61. configure.in
  62. COPYING.Ylonen
  63. crc32.c
  64. crc32.h
  65. CREDITS
  66. deattack.c
  67. deattack.h
  68. defines.h
  69. dispatch.c
  70. dispatch.h
  71. dsa.c
  72. dsa.h
  73. entropy.c
  74. entropy.h
  75. fake-gai-errnos.h
  76. fake-getaddrinfo.c
  77. fake-getaddrinfo.h
  78. fake-getnameinfo.c
  79. fake-getnameinfo.h
  80. fake-socket.h
  81. fingerprint.c
  82. fingerprint.h
  83. fixpaths
  84. fixprogs
  85. getput.h
  86. hmac.c
  87. hmac.h
  88. hostfile.c
  89. hostfile.h
  90. includes.h
  91. INSTALL
  92. install-sh
  93. kex.c
  94. kex.h
  95. key.c
  96. key.h
  97. log-client.c
  98. log-server.c
  99. log.c
  100. login.c
  101. loginrec.c
  102. loginrec.h
  103. logintest.c
  104. Makefile.in
  105. match.c
  106. match.h
  107. md5crypt.c
  108. md5crypt.h
  109. mkinstalldirs
  110. mpaux.c
  111. mpaux.h
  112. myproposal.h
  113. nchan.c
  114. nchan.h
  115. nchan.ms
  116. nchan2.ms
  117. next-posix.c
  118. next-posix.h
  119. openbsd-compat.h
  120. OVERVIEW
  121. packet.c
  122. packet.h
  123. pty.c
  124. pty.h
  125. radix.c
  126. readconf.c
  127. readconf.h
  128. README
  129. README.openssh2
  130. README.Ylonen
  131. readpass.c
  132. RFC.nroff
  133. rsa.c
  134. rsa.h
  135. scp.1
  136. scp.c
  137. servconf.c
  138. servconf.h
  139. serverloop.c
  140. session.c
  141. session.h
  142. ssh-add.1
  143. ssh-add.c
  144. ssh-agent.1
  145. ssh-agent.c
  146. ssh-keygen.1
  147. ssh-keygen.c
  148. ssh.1
  149. ssh.c
  150. ssh.h
  151. ssh2.h
  152. ssh_config
  153. ssh_prng_cmds.in
  154. sshconnect.c
  155. sshconnect.h
  156. sshconnect1.c
  157. sshconnect2.c
  158. sshd.8
  159. sshd.c
  160. sshd_config
  161. tildexpand.c
  162. TODO
  163. ttymodes.c
  164. ttymodes.h
  165. uidswap.c
  166. uidswap.h
  167. UPGRADING
  168. uuencode.c
  169. uuencode.h
  170. version.h
  171. xmalloc.c
  172. xmalloc.h